Sara Falligant | Opelika-Auburn News | Twitter Auburn University students looking for a quicker way around campus won’t have to look far starting this summer. By mid-2015, the university will boast a free bike share program for students, thanks to Charleston, South Carolina, based Gotcha Ride. “You’ve seen them in big cities like New York and London,” Parking Services Manager Don Andrae said, explaining the free bike share program will be similar to paid ones in large cities. The 75 blue, three-gear bikes will be situated in corrals in high-traffic areas like campus dorms, Tiger Transit hubs and the Haley Center concourse. Sara Falligant | Opelika-Auburn News | Twitter Auburn University launched its new collegiate car tag this month, which was designed based on input from Alabama Auburn graduates. The tag features the interlocking AU logo on the left—the original AU vanity tag featured Samford Hall, but was changed to the interlocking AU in 1992—a blue stripe at the bottom with “Auburn” in white and “Alabama” at the top in an orange stripe. Fans who purchase the tag can also personalize the available six characters for free. Discovery Hike Sponsored by Kreher Preserve & Nature Center Explore the preserve and learn something new each month about plants, wildlife and nature with a trained naturalist who will offer your family fun opportunities for hands-on learning, exploration, and exercise! Discovery Hikes are offered the second Tuesday of each month from 3:30 – 4:30 p.m. For families with children ages 5 to 12. Each month features a new seasonal theme. Groups meet at the pavilion. Guided tours are free. Donations are welcomed. Cancelled in the event of rain. Hikes are not offered in June. By Alabama Center for Real Estate (ACRE)  Click here to view or print the entire November report compliments of the ACRE Corporate Cabinet. Alabama residential sales totaled 3,072 units in November, virtually matching the volume from the same period a year earlier and 194 units below our monthly forecast. While the increase was by one unit, November represents the fifth consecutive month whereby sales have eclipsed last year's pace. Nationally, November sales were 2.1 percent above the same period last year. See more details of how Alabama compares to the broader US market here. By Alabama Center for Real Estate (ACRE)  Click here to view or print the entire November report compliments of the ACRE Corporate Cabinet. Monthly Sales: Lee County residential sales totaled 69 units in November, a decrease in sales growth of 11.5 percent from the same period a year earlier. November sales were 9 units below our monthly forecast. The year-to-date sales forecast through November projected 1,256 closed transactions while actual closings were 1,277 units representing a favorably cumulative variance of 1.7 percent. AUBURN, Alabama -- Once catering to high-temperature days spent carelessly drifting along the lazy river or shooting at high speeds down the body flumes, Auburn's Surfside Water Park now sits stagnant as nothing more than a set of abandoned structures that have some Auburn residents concerned for its future. "The abandoned water park is an eyesore and a public nuisance, and it's shameful that the city shows so little concern about the appearance of the southern entrance to the Loveliest Village," said John Varner, who has lived in the area since 1977. According to revenue office records, the park on Highway29/South College Street closed in July 2012. Photo by Brian Woodham Tesla Supercharger station  Clarence Harbison of Instrument Technical Services installs a Tesla Supercharger station outside the Auburn Mall.  Posted: Tuesday, December 23, 2014 1:08 pm Brian Woodham – brian@auburnvillager.com |0 comments The Auburn Mall will soon be supercharged. As part of the expansion of Tesla Motor Co.'s network of charging stations across the country, a new Tesla Supercharger station is being built in the parking lot of Auburn Mall across the street from the Lee County Courthouse Satellite Office. "We are looking to expand the Supercharger network all over the nation, with particular interest along routes between major cities," said a spokesperson from Tesla. By Amber Sutton | asutton@al.com Email the author | Follow on Twitter on December 17, 2014 at 10:30 AM Auburn University (File photo)Steve Doyle | sdoyle@al.com  AUBURN, Alabama -- Auburn University's architecture, industrial design and interior design programs were ranked among the nation's best in a annual survey, "America's Best Architecture and Design Schools 2015," byDesignIntelligence magazine. DesignIntelligence ranked Auburn's undergraduate Industrial Design program, which is in the School of Industrial and Graphic Design in the College of Architecture, Design and Construction, eighth in the nation and third in the South based on annual surveys of leading practitioners in their fields, The program has been ranked in the national top 10 since 2007. Sara Falligant | Opelika-Auburn News | Twitter Spotlights danced over East University Drive Tuesday to announce the grand opening of Auburn’s Carmike Wynnsong 14 BigD auditorium. The state-of-the-art theater boasts a 70-foot by three-and-a-half-story screen and roughly 545 custom luxury seats. “It’s definitely going to be an experience you can feel as well as see,” manager Tobias Farley said. Auburn’s Wynnsong is one of fewer than 30 Carmike theaters nationwide to feature the BigD experience. Formerly the Wynnsong 16, the BigD auditorium combined three existing auditoriums to create the premium moviegoing experience.
